The CLS is sponsored by the U.S. Department of State and offers fully funded summer language institutes for U.S. university students. Successful applicants spend 8-10 weeks overseas during the summer learning Arabic, Azerbaijani, Bangla, Chinese, Hindi, Indonesian, Japanese, Korean, Persian, Punjabi, Russian, Turkish, or Urdu.
